Replace Batteries Correctly

The number one cause of a Fitbit scale won’t turn on is dead or improperly installed batteries. These scales require three AA alkaline batteries, and even one weak cell can stop power delivery entirely.

Use Fresh AA Alkaline Cells

Start by removing all batteries from your scale. Insert brand-new, high-quality AA alkaline cells such as Duracell or Energizer. Make sure the negative ends face the springs inside the compartment. Never mix old and new batteries, and avoid using rechargeable NiMH batteries unless verified as compatible.

Check Polarity and Orientation

Misaligned polarity is a silent killer that prevents power even when batteries appear seated. Double-check each battery orientation carefully. The positive end should connect to the flat terminal, while the negative end touches the spring. All three batteries must follow the exact same pattern.

Test Battery Voltage

Use a multimeter to verify each battery reads at least 1.5V. The combined voltage across terminals should read approximately 4.5V. If any battery shows lower voltage, replace all three immediately.

Clean Battery Contacts

Corroded or dirty battery contacts can block electrical flow even with fresh batteries installed. This is a common culprit when your Fitbit scale won’t turn on.

Inspect for Corrosion

Remove the batteries and examine the contact points inside the compartment. Look for white or green crusty deposits, pitting on the metal surfaces, or sticky residue. These are signs of corrosion that need attention.

Remove and Clean Safely

Dip a cotton swab in isopropyl alcohol at 70% concentration or higher. Gently scrub each contact point to remove corrosion and residue. Allow the compartment to dry completely for 5 to 10 minutes before reinserting batteries. Never use water or vinegar, as these can worsen corrosion.

Check Spring Tension

Press each spring to verify it rebounds firmly. Weak springs fail to hold batteries securely, causing intermittent contact. If springs feel loose or bent, the battery tray may need replacement.

Perform Hard Reset (Aria Air)

If your Fitbit scale won’t turn on despite fresh batteries and clean contacts, a hard reset can clear software locks that might be causing the issue.

Trigger Factory Reset

For Fitbit Aria Air models, insert working batteries and locate the pinhole reset button on the underside of the scale. Press and hold this button for approximately 5 seconds. Watch for the display to show “OT,” which indicates the reset has initiated. Release the button and wait 1 second, then press and hold again for 5 seconds. Look for “CLR” to appear, confirming the reset is complete.

Reset Fails? Power Issue Likely

If no display appears during the reset attempt, the problem is likely power-related rather than software-based. This means you need to investigate batteries, contacts, or internal wiring further.

Diagnose Internal Wiring Faults

Some users have discovered hidden internal wiring issues that external inspection misses. This step requires opening your scale, which voids the warranty.

Open the Scale Safely

Gather a precision Phillips screwdriver and a plastic prying tool. Remove the screws from the bottom of the scale and gently separate the base from the glass top. Lift the cover carefully without pulling on any wires.

Inspect Battery Wires

User reports confirm that a red positive wire from the battery terminal can detach internally even when external connections look fine. Check that both battery terminal wires are securely attached with no fraying or broken solder joints. Gently tug each wire to ensure it doesn’t pull free.

Reattach Loose Wires

If you find a detached wire, strip 2mm of insulation and re-solder it to the terminal pad. Secure it with hot glue to prevent future strain. If you’re not comfortable with soldering, consider replacing the unit instead.

Test Setup Mode Manually

This indirect test checks whether your scale powers at all, even without a display.

Force Power Cycle

Go to fitbit.com/scale/setup/start in your web browser and begin the setup process. Remove one battery from the scale, wait 10 seconds, then reinsert it quickly. The scale should display “Wi-Fi is,” “Tap to change,” or “Step on” if it’s receiving power.

No Display? Hardware Failure Confirmed

A blank screen after this test confirms power delivery failure, a dead PCB, or damaged display. If batteries, contacts, and reset all check out but you still get no display, the internal hardware is likely faulty and requires replacement.

Prevent Future Power Failures

Taking preventive measures can stop your Fitbit scale won’t turn on from happening again.

Replace Batteries Proactively

Set a calendar reminder to replace AA batteries every 6 to 10 months, even if the scale seems functional. Preventive maintenance is far easier than troubleshooting a dead unit.

Store in Dry Environment

Humidity kills electronics. Never leave your scale in steamy bathrooms, on cold concrete floors, or near showers or sinks. Moisture causes corrosion and contact failure over time.

Avoid Physical Damage

Always lift the scale rather than dragging it across surfaces. Place it on flat, stable areas away from high traffic zones. One fall can crack internal circuit boards and cause permanent failure.

When to Replace the Scale

Sometimes repair isn’t worth the effort, and replacement makes more sense.

Check Warranty Status

Fitbit offers a 1-year limited warranty covering manufacturing defects. It does not cover battery wear, water damage, or drops. If under warranty with a non-functional scale, contact Fitbit support with proof of purchase.

Repair vs. Replace

DIY repair is possible but risky. Ask yourself whether the PCB is cracked, if display flex cables are damaged, and whether you have soldering tools and skills. If the answer is yes to any of these, replacement is the safer option.
